I will be hosting a Memorial Day Bbq in our local park. The Mixed Grill Bbq will be just exquisite because I can make-and-take it to the park in (you guessed it) 30 minutes - flat! The meal is very transportable so you can take it where ever you are going, too.
For our appetizer policy while folks are gathering, we will have an At-The-Cheese-Ball appetizer course. This will be the exquisite accompaniment to our casual Bbq. The policy includes cheddar cheese balls; summer sausage with roasted garlic mustard; veg tray with sliced pears and spicy tomato salsa; tortilla chips, savory herb crackers, and honey roasted almonds.
You will find that I use any cooking methods, mix and match, to get supper on the table quickly! (The ingredients in parenthesis show some of my quick-prep steps.) You can all the time substitute your favorite made-from-scratch recipes when you have more time.

Sunday:
Breast of Chicken en Croute (boneless, skinless chicken breasts, crescent rolls)
Roasted Brussels Sprouts & Pearl Onions (frozen pearl onions)
Egg and Tomato Salad with Pink Mayo
Pears Especialle (canned pears)
Monday (Memorial Day):
Mixed Grill Bbq Party
3-Bean Salad (jarred 3-bean salad)
Cole Slaw (bagged slaw mix, jarred slaw dressing)
Corn on the Cob
Potato Chips
Baked Beans (canned beans)
Grilled Fruit Skewers with Lemon Dip (purchased yogurt)
Tuesday:
Cream of Broccoli Soup (vegetarian)
Artichoke Crostini (jarred artichokes)
Caramelized Peaches
Wednesday:
Fiesta Chicken (boneless, skinless chicken breasts, Ro*Tel canned tomatoes)
Yellow Rice (boxed rice mix)
Mexi-Corn (canned corn)
Pear Salad (canned pears)
Banana Pudding (purchased vanilla wafers, instant pudding mix)
Thursday:
Meatball Stew (frozen meatballs)
Bread Bowls (refrigerated biscuits)
Fruit Salad (canned fruits)
Buckeye Chocolate Chippers (prepared cookie dough, canned chocolate frosting)
Friday:
Not-Your Mamma's Tuna Salad
Rolls
Lemon Phyllo Cups (phyllo cups, lemon pudding mix)
Saturday:
French Burgers with White Wine Sauce
Egg Noodles (purchased noodles)
Asparagus
Peach Melba Parfaits (purchased ice cream, canned peaches, jarred raspberry jam)
